Advertising revenue rate slows as macroeconomic pressures continue: PwC 2024 Entertainment and Media Outlook

Despite macroeconomic challenges, revenue for the media and entertainment industry in Australia in 2023 was up 2.8% year-on-year, while a “content boom” is expected to come in 2025, according to PwC’s 2024 Entertainment and Media Outlook.

Revenue rose to AU$62.3 billion in 2023, compared to AU$60.6 billion the previous year.

While the revenue growth has remained positive, the rate at which is has grown has slowed down, due to increasing pressures including rising inflation, interest rate hikes and the cost-of-living crisis. 2023 saw a rate of just 2.8%, compared to 2022’s 6.6%.
